在Pandas中,DataFrame是一个二维的表格数据结构,类似于关系型数据库中的表。要擦除DataFrame中的寄存器,可以使用drop()方法。
drop()方法可以删除指定的行或列。如果要删除行,可以指定axis参数为0;如果要删除列,可以指定axis参数为1。此外,可以通过指定labels参数来指定要删除的行或列的标签。
下面是一个示例代码:
import pandas as pd
# 创建一个DataFrame
data = {'Name': ['Tom', 'Nick', 'John', 'Sam'],
'Age': [20, 25, 30, 35],
'City': ['New York', 'Paris', 'London', 'Tokyo']}
df = pd.DataFrame(data)
# 删除指定行
df = df.drop([1, 3]) # 删除索引为1和3的行
# 删除指定列
df = df.drop('Age', axis=1) # 删除名为'Age'的列
print(df)
输出结果为:
Name City
0 Tom New York
2 John London
在这个例子中,我们首先创建了一个包含姓名、年龄和城市的DataFrame。然后,使用drop()方法删除了索引为1和3的行,以及名为'Age'的列。最后,打印出删除后的DataFrame。
对于这个问题,如果需要更具体的解答,可以提供更多的上下文信息,以便给出更准确的答案。
领取专属 10元无门槛券
手把手带您无忧上云